Your Responsibilities as a Workshop Controller

As the primary Controller for the site, you will be the lynchpin of the workshop's success, driving efficiency and compliance across all operations in Reading.

Operational Management: Maximise sold hours and efficiency by creating job cards, pre-timing jobs, and intelligently allocating work to technicians.

Quality & Compliance: Ensure 100% sign-off on completed inspections to keep customer Operator's Licenses safe and legal.

Administration & Flow: Monitor and manage workshop loading, accurately issue VOR (Vehicle Off Road) reports, and audit job packs for accurate Admin/invoicing.

Team Leadership: Measure technician performance and activity, driving a first-time fix culture focused on quality and compliance.

Process Adherence: Ensure all workshop processes, including warranty item identification and processing, service checks, and statutory requirements (H&S, vehicle legislation), are rigorously adhered to in Reading.

Requirements for this Leadership Role

To step into this challenging Workshop Controller position in Reading, you will need:

Leadership: Proven experience in a Workshop Controller or supervisory role within a commercial vehicle environment.

Skills: Strong understanding of workshop processes, compliance, and Operator's License responsibilities is essential.

Drive: Ability to lead, inspire, motivate, and manage a team of technicians, focused on delivering efficiency, profitability, and compliance.

IT & Organisation: Excellent organisational and scheduling skills, plus good IT skills (experience with R2C, Truckfile, Kerridge, etc., is advantageous).
